Plant systems presentations for Grade 6 students provide comprehensive visual learning resources that break down the complex structures and functions of plant anatomy through structured instruction and concept explanation. These educational materials guide students through the fundamental components of plant biology, including root systems, stem structures, leaf functions, and reproductive organs, while developing critical scientific observation skills and botanical vocabulary. The presentations utilize diagrams, illustrations, and step-by-step explanations to help sixth-grade learners understand how different plant parts work together as interconnected systems, fostering deeper comprehension of photosynthesis, nutrient transport, water absorption, and plant reproduction processes.
